What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a school program aide?

To thrive as a School Program Aide, you need a high school diploma or equivalent, basic knowledge of educational practices, and experience working with children. Familiarity with classroom technology, educational software, and basic first aid certification are often required. Strong communication, patience, and organizational skills help you support teachers and engage students effectively. These abilities are crucial for maintaining a safe, positive learning environment and ensuring smooth operation of school programs.

What are the duties of a school program aide?

A school program aide assists teachers and staff by supervising students, helping with classroom activities, and supporting special programs. They may also help with administrative tasks, ensure student safety, and promote a positive learning environment. Strong communication skills and the ability to follow instructions are important for this role.

What is a school program aide?

School Program Aides are support staff who assist teachers and school administrators with classroom activities, supervision, and other tasks that help create a positive learning environment. They may work one-on-one with students, help prepare instructional materials, supervise students during recess or lunch, and provide additional help to students who need it. Their role is essential in ensuring that classrooms run smoothly and that all students receive the support they need to succeed.

Do school program aides get paid in the summer?

School program aides are typically paid only during the school year when programs are active. Some districts may offer summer employment or extended contracts, but generally, summer pay is not standard unless specified in the employment agreement or if the aide works in summer programs. Availability of summer pay depends on the school district's policies and funding.
